alpha-D-Manp-(1->2)-alpha-D-Manp-(1->3)-[alpha-D-Manp-(1->3)-[alpha-D-Manp-(1->2)-alpha-D-Manp-(1->6)]-alpha-D-Manp-(1->6)]-beta-D-Manp-(1->4)-beta-D-GlcpNAc-(1->4)-D-GlcpNAc > An amino nonasaccharide that is the linear pentasaccharide α-D-Man-(1→2)-α-D-Man-(1→3)-β-D-Man-(1→4)-β-D-GlcNAc-(1→4)-D-GlcNAc in which the mannosyl residue nearest the reducing end has the branched tetrasaccharide α-D-Man-(1→3)-[α-D-Man-(1→2)-α-D-Man-(1→6)]-α-D-Man attached at position 6. > 3 >
